Tom and Jerry Batter
This is by far the tastiest and easiest recipe for classic Tom and Jerry batter.
Course: Christmas, Drinks
Servings: 16 servings
- 6 eggs, separated
- 1/2 teaspoon cream of tartar sauce
- 1 pound powdered sugar
- 1 7-ounce jar of marshmallow cream
- Hot water, rum, brandy, nutmeg for the drink
Separate the 6 eggs being careful to get no yolk in the egg whites
Beat the egg whites with cream of tartar until still peaks form.
Beat egg yolks in separate bowl until thick and light colored.
Stir the marshmallow creme into the egg yolks.
Gently fold egg whites into the egg yolk mixture. Refrigerate until needed.
To make a Tom and Jerry, fill a cup with a 1/2 shot of each rum and brandy. Add a large dollop of Tom and Jerry batter. Next add boiling water and top with a sprinkle of nutmeg. Enjoy.
